Calculate the distance from the bulb to the corner of the table (I assume that's what you mean by tip).
{{{R^2=1.8^2+1^2+1^2}}}
{{{R^2=3.24+1+1}}}
{{{R^2=5.24}}}
Illuminance is inversely proportional to the square of the distance.
{{{k/1.8^2=300}}}
{{{k/5.24=X}}}
{{{X=300(3.24/5.24)}}}
{{{X=185.5}}}{{{lx}}}
Since the distance from the source to the edge of the table is 1.8 down, 1 up, and 1 over, the source is no longer directly over the point but at an angle,{{{ theta}}}.
{{{tan(theta)=sqrt(1^2+1^2)/1.8}}}
{{{theta=38.2}}} degrees
{{{En=X*cos(theta)=185.5*cos(38.2)=145.7}}} lx
